피드로 돌아가기
GeekNewsDevOps
원문 읽기
Google Workspace CLI를 만든 개발자, 구글에서 해고됨
Workspace API 추상화 CLI 개발 및 무단 배포로 인한 거버넌스 충돌 사례
AI 요약
Context
Google Workspace의 분산된 API(Drive, Gmail, Calendar 등)를 통합 관리하는 고수준 추상화 레이어의 필요성 증대. 기존의 개별 API 호출 방식은 개발자 경험(DX) 및 에이전트 자동화 구현에 높은 진입 장벽으로 작용함.
Technical Solution
- Workspace API 전체를 통합 제어하는 Unified CLI Interface 설계
- 사람과 AI Agent 모두 활용 가능한 범용 인터페이스 레이어 구축
- 복잡한 API 인증 및 호출 과정을 단순화한 오픈소스 추상화 래퍼 구현
- 내부 DevRel 관점의 API 활용 패턴을 CLI 형태로 제품화하여 배포
- 공식 SDK 대비 낮은 진입 장벽을 제공하는 Command-line 기반 제어 로직 적용
- 외부 저장소(GitHub)를 통한 빠른 배포 및 사용자 피드백 루프 형성
실천 포인트
- 기업 내부 리소스 활용 프로젝트의 외부 공개 전 Legal 및 Compliance 승인 절차 준수 - Corporate Identity(로고, 브랜드 색상) 사용 시 상표권 및 공식 제품 오인 가능성 검토 - 오픈소스 기여 시 소속 회사의 Open Source Policy(예: go/opensource) 확인 - 제품 출시 전 내부 로드맵과의 충돌 여부 및 Disruption 가능성 사전 조율